17. The article The Lead Content and Acidity of Christchurch Precipitation (New Zeal. J. Sci., 1980:
311—312) reports the accompanying data on lead concentration (mg/L) in samples gathered during eight differentsummerrainfalls: 17.0, 21.4, 30.6, 5.0, 12.2, 11.8, 17.3, and 18.8. Assuming that the leadcontent distribution is symmetric, use theWilcoxon signed-rank interval to obtain a 95% CI for m.
